Hi RC-jj,
Let me guess, 85% pre built? Ha Ha. My mate bought one of these and asked me to help him as he is more into fixed wing. My Trex 450 was pre built and I thought this would be the same, more or less, as mine was 95% built, how much differance could there be?
When we opened the box I was stunned, the only bits pre built were the upper head, tail gearbox and 4 screws in the side frames.
Well, my mate knows his 450 pretty well now as he sat with me as we built it, then another mate got one and I built that too with BOTH of them watching. You can make a lot of friends building these things.
In truth they are more fiddly than difficualt, one tip, don't try and test fly it a 3am, silly things happen, like when I mounted the gyro on its side cos it was a different make from mine and I was too tired to check. Heli survived, small dent in pride only.
Enjoy the build, when you know it inside out you will have no fear when it comes to repairs, maintenance or upgrades.

its easy follow the directions lol. this is the best thing that could have happened to you! Now you will know what you have and it will be done rite and above all you,ll be on a faster learning curve then any new guys who are starting the same as you.

now with everything locktited properly you will have less problems and dont have to tear down the new heli just to check the last guys build.

and like the other guys have said your going to wreck it and wreck it allot youll be tearing into it anyway on way or another.

taking your time you can finish a 450 in a day or so, your first time it may take you a bit longer but not much.

a must see is bob whites [finless] build videos at helifreak http://www.helifreak.com/forumdisplay.php?f=60

follow this guy as most of us did when we were new and your build will go smooth and youll get all the inside tips youll need
